Im having a few issues trying to figure out the syntax to convolute two discrete impulse functions. any help on the syntax would be great. here are the two signals
x[n]= -delta[n+1] + 0.5delta[n] + 2delta[n-1] h[n]= 2delta[n] + delta[n-1]

x[n]= -delta[n+1] + 0.5delta[n] + 2delta[n-1]
h[n]= 2delta[n] + delta[n-1]
"I don't know how to write the two signals in matlab"
So basically your signals are
x = [-1, 0.5, 2];
h = [1, 2];
You can convolve the two signals by using
y = conv(x, h);
Use the different options (under the heading 'shape' in the input arguments part) given in the help section and see which one is suitable for your use.
